Summary
Stefan Fatsis and Josh Levin are joined by Grant Wahl to talk about the U.S. men’s national team’s dominant win over Mexico. Stefan, Josh, and Joel Anderson then discuss how ESPN’s Adam Schefter covered a domestic abuse allegation against Vikings running back Dalvin Cook. Finally, they look into the war of words between the NBA’s Morris twins and Jokic brothers.
USA-Mexico (3:36): Is the USMNT’s big win a sign that the rivalry has shifted?
Schefter (22:20): The journalistic sins of ESPN’s lead NFL insider.
Morris vs. Jokic (48:10): What makes a good sibling Twitter basketball beef?
Afterball (1:06:20): The groundbreaking 1960 documentary on NFL linebacker Sam Huff.
